Title: Scheduler double-waters bed 3 after DST shift

New folks: the Verdella scheduler stores watering slots in local time. After the clock change, slot 06:00 fires twice, soaking the herb bed. Fix: store UTC, convert at display. Repro on the Oakhollow test rig only. To reproduce, install the firmware identified by the token below.

build token for hafop-kahog: htk31_a432ac515d5bb1362002c1e1a7e80ef

Changelog 2.9.0 — Encoding detection defaults changed

The Quincewater upload service no longer assumes UTF-8 for text files. Detection now runs the Larkspur sniffer first, falling back to the declared header charset, then UTF-8. Files flagged ambiguous are quarantined instead of silently transcoded, which fixes the mojibake reports from the Bexhill pilot. Flag to discuss at sync: whether quarantine thresholds are too aggressive. New defaults shipped with this release are listed below.

deployment values, kajep-kageg:
[praix]
host = praix.paliqcorp.corp
user = praix_svc
database = praix_prod

Ticket: Undo corrupts connector anchors in Sketchforge diagram editor.

Repro:
1. New canvas, add two shapes, connect them.
2. Drag shape B, then undo twice.
3. Redo once.

Expected: connector reattaches to original anchor. Actual: connector floats, anchor null. Happens on v4.2 only. Affects three Dunmarsh Labs customers so far. To pull the session replay from the diagnostics API, authenticate with the bearer token below.

session JWT of yawep-yawep = eyJhbGciOiJIUzI1NiIsInR5cCI6IkpXVCJ9.eyJzdWIiOiI3pWF3_In0.aXYsHiog

Ticket #— Floor 9 Opening Prep, Brindlemoor House

Hi facilities folks, Floor 9 opens to staff next Monday and we need a few things squared away before then. Lift access is live, but the two side doors by the kitchenette are still on the old lock config — please reprogram them before Friday. Also, signage for the quiet rooms hasn't arrived, so pop up the temporary printed ones for now. Until the badge readers sync, the interim door code for Floor 9 is below.

door code, bajop-bajog: bdg-DSWAC-43621